pycharm安裝pyinstaller將pygame打包成exe

首先,使用pycharm自帶的下載包工具,File-Settings-Project Interpreter,如圖:python

 

安裝完成後,發現安裝到了Python根目錄下,個人在C:\python34\Scripts\下,以下圖,注意這個目錄,注意這個pyinstaller.exe工具

 

打開cmd:注意初始情況以下圖,目錄定位在奇怪的地方字體

 

利用Linux操做指令,以下圖
cd \  進入根目錄
cd ??? 進入???文件夾
一直進入到pyinstaller.exe所在的地方ui

 

應當把須要打包的文件放在pyinstaller.exe所在的目錄下,否則是找不到的,同時,有附帶的圖片文件等也放在一塊兒,否則打包失敗
而後輸入pyinstaller -w -F game1.py   (game1.py是當前打包的內容,-w是單個文件,-F是exe文件,具體參數可自行搜索).net

因而在C:\python34\Scripts\目錄下多了build和dist文件夾,以及game1.spec過程文件,以下圖:blog

 

打開dist文件,就有可執行的exe文件了遊戲

額外的,我轉成exe後,打不開,
問題failed to execute script
解決:
myfront = pygame.font.Font(None, 36)
改成
myfront = pygame.font.SysFont('arial',36)
由於轉爲exe文件後沒有自帶的字體,只有使用系統字體圖片

OK,如今能夠將遊戲exe帶到其餘電腦上玩啦ip


---------------------
做者:執契
來源:CSDN
原文:https://blog.csdn.net/qq_36187544/article/details/86550376
版權聲明:本文爲博主原創文章,轉載請附上博文連接!pycharm

相關文章
相關標籤/搜索